Unveiling The Secrets Of Robert Kiyosaki's Net Worth

Robert Kiyosaki, an acclaimed financial literacy advocate and author, has garnered significant attention for his expertise in personal finance. His prominence stems from his bestselling book, "Rich Dad Poor Dad," which has sold over 32 million copies globally.

Kiyosaki's financial acumen has translated into substantial wealth, making his net worth a subject of considerable interest. According to Celebrity Net Worth, Kiyosaki's net worth is estimated to be approximately $100 million. This wealth has been amassed through various ventures, including his involvement in real estate, education, and financial services.
